Q: Is 18,461,370 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 18,461,370 is not a prime number.

Why is 18,461,370 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 18461370 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 10 15 30 615,379 1,230,758 1,846,137 3,076,895 3,692,274 6,153,790 9,230,685 and 18,461,370, with no remainder.

Since 18,461,370 cannot be divided by just 1 and 18,461,370, it is not a prime number.
